#701ef5 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#701ef5 is composed of 43.9% red, 11.8%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.3% cyan, 87.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 262.9 degrees, a saturation of 91.5% and a lightness of 53.9%. #701ef5 color hex could be obtained by blending #e03cff with #0000eb.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

● #701ef5 color description : Vivid violet.
The hexadecimal color #701ef5 has RGB values of R:112, G:30, B:245 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0.88,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 7347957.
